Tom Moody criticizes PBKS auction strategy after Shreyas Iyer's record bid

hindustantimes.com

Punjab Kings (PBKS) made headlines at the IPL 2025 auction by acquiring Shreyas Iyer for ₹ 26.75 crore, briefly making him the most expensive player in IPL history. This record was soon surpassed by Rishabh Pant, who was bought for ₹ 27 crore. Former coach Tom Moody criticized PBKS's auction strategy, suggesting it was poorly planned. He noted that the team quickly spent a large portion of their budget, leaving them with ₹ 65.75 crore remaining from an initial ₹ 110.5 crore. PBKS also used the Right to Match option to bring back pacer Arshdeep Singh for ₹ 18 crore. Iyer is expected to captain the team in the upcoming season after leading Kolkata Knight Riders to their IPL title in 2024.
